I hate to be the bearer of bad news, but it looks like Escient is ceasing operations.
From their website:

Regarding the Consumer business, going forward, we will be focusing on our core consumer brands—Denon, Marantz, McIntosh, and Boston Acoustics—and we will be rolling out new products throughout the year. As part of the focus on these four core brands, we will be repositioning our Escient business model, discontinuing Escient branded products in order to utilize all of the company’s expertise toward incorporating its innovative technologies into our core D&M brands. During this transition, Escient will deliver necessary software upgrades for its existing products and will continue to support its dealers and customers by honoring warranty repairs and maintaining customer service. Additionally, in order to keep the focus on our core brands, we will be discontinuing the operation of Snell Acoustics. The changing landscape of the speaker industry has made it extremely difficult for Snell to remain a viable business. The advanced loudspeaker technologies developed at Snell, however, will be leveraged by other D&M brands.
